25019662316 has 24 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 48875623104. Its totient is φ = 11108094480.
The previous prime is 25019662313. The next prime is 25019662321. The reversal of 25019662316 is 61326691052.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(25019662313)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 7 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 6610070 + ... + 6613853.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(2036484296).
Almost surely, 225019662316 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
25019662316 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(23855960788).
25019662316 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
25019662316 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 13223981 (or 13223979 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 116640, while the sum is 41.
